What tense should be used when writing an Incident Report? 

Past tense.

What are 2 things you shouldn't do if you get a call for a physical altercation?

Put yourself in between the parties or try to solve it yourself.

How do you determine if an incident is a medical emergency?

There is severe illness, injury that should be addressed, allergic reaction, seizure, or a student is requesting medical assistance.

NOTE: You should NEVER be providing medical assistance to a resident while you are acting in the role of a Resident Advisor (RA).

When writing an Incident Report, when should your narrative as a responding RA end? 

When the incident is complete, NOT when an Area Coordinator (AC) arrives.

What is one non-verbal behavior that can help de-escalate a conflict.

Open posture, getting to the same level as a resident in distress, calm tone of voice.

What is a "muster point" and when would you direct students to one?

A designated safe location away from a building, used during an emergency such as a fire alarm activation.

A resident asks to have a talk with you, but explicitly requests that you don't tell anyone about the conversation. What should you do?

You should inform the resident that you are a private resource NOT a confidential resource and that there are policies and procedures that require you to report information to professional staff members on campus.
